From f87c3d7e11abb6d618e041417d42d831ede040e6 Mon Sep 17 00:00:00 2001 From: EnderIce2 Date: Fri, 4 Apr 2025 04:14:19 +0000 Subject: [PATCH] feat(kernel/tty): add TCSETS Signed-off-by: EnderIce2 --- Kernel/tty/vt.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/Kernel/tty/vt.cpp b/Kernel/tty/vt.cpp index b0bf42aa..774e6d91 100644 --- a/Kernel/tty/vt.cpp +++ b/Kernel/tty/vt.cpp @@ -143,6 +143,12 @@ namespace KernelConsole *t = TerminalConfig; return 0; } + case TCSETS: + { + struct termios *t = (struct termios *)Argp; + TerminalConfig = *t; + return 0; + } case TCSETSW: { debug("draining output buffer...");